Origin Story

Smallholder Farmers

This is Equator’s first year purchasing coffee from the Gesha Karmach farm, which was established in 2019. Located in southwest Ethiopia, near the Gori Gesha forest, the farm benefits from the ideal conditions for the cultivation of high quality coffee. The region is best known for the original discovery of the renowned Gesha variety, which the farm cultivates alongside indigenous heirloom varieties.

While deforestation has altered much of Ethiopia’s landscape, Bench Maji remains one of the last strongholds of native forest. The trees form a natural green dome under which coffee thrives. As it expands, the farm remains committed to sustainable development that respects the land and the local communities—including the local Bench, Me’en, and Amhara communities, who have long depended on the forest and its resources.

Why We Love This Coffee

This represents the second of two lots Equator purchased from the Gesha Karmach farm this season. This lot was processed using the washed method. After harvesting, the coffee cherries were removed before the seeds were fermented and dried, resulting in a coffee with a gentle fruitiness and florality.

The Equator roasting team approached this delicate coffee with an intention to not mask the white tea and chamomile notes in the coffee. The total roast duration was kept relatively short, with a lot of heat applied at the start of the roast due to this coffee’s high density.
